Leaders of Newport’s Faith Communities and Governing Authorities are cordially invited to a brief but informative meeting on Wednesday 12th November 2008, 12.00 noon – 1.30 pm, at Duckpool Road Baptist Church, 54 Duckpool Road, Newport (lunch provided – donations welcome). Both parties have aspirations for serving the welfare of our citizens and the meeting seeks a new level of cooperative action and expediency to enable this.
Gweini’s John M. Evans, Strategic Director and author of the “Wales Faith Audit“, along with Jim Stewart, Policy Director, will be presenting the findings specifically for Newport. The report shows the high level of service currently afforded by faith-based volunteers; it also highlights that considerably more will be achieved as parties increase collaboration. Faith-based communities constitute a potential army of volunteers who are willing, dedicated and compassionate, but who need training, leadership and resources to get better mobilized.
We will also brooch the possibility of STREET PASTORS for Newport.
